
Cameron Shinn focused on improving memory accounting within the StreamHPC/rocm-libraries repository, addressing a critical bug that affected the accuracy of performance metrics. By refining the calculation of memory usage for Key and Value objects, Cameron replaced the use of a general nhead parameter with nhead_k, ensuring that reported memory consumption now aligns with actual resource requirements. This C++-based fix eliminated inflated num_byte values, which previously led to misleading performance data and resource planning challenges. Cameron’s work in memory management and performance optimization enhanced the reliability of reported metrics, supporting more accurate capacity planning for high-performance computing workloads.
